In memoriam Eesti kroon

Textile artist Elna Kaasik is inspired by the history of Estonian kroon in her work based on banknotes. The artist weaves carpets out of newspaper and banknote strips for the exhibition "Estonian Applied Art Slingshot 2011" - she calls her work as death cloths of the first Estonian currency. Estonian kroon was effective in the Republic of Estonia in 1924-1941 and was again taken into use in 1992 when Estonia regained its independence.
